Understanding the Core Skills Required for Clinical Coding Analytics

The first step in mastering clinical coding analytics is understanding the core skills that this certificate aims to develop. These skills are crucial for making informed decisions based on data-driven insights. Key among these are:

1. Knowledge of Healthcare Terminologies: Familiarity with medical terminologies such as 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CS codes is essential. These codes are the backbone of clinical coding and are used to document patient encounters and medical procedures accurately.

2. Data Analysis and Interpretation: The ability to analyze and interpret large sets of clinical data is fundamental. This includes understanding how to use statistical tools and software to extract meaningful insights from complex datasets.

3. Interdisciplinary Collaboration: Effective communication and collaboration with healthcare professionals such as physicians, nurses, and IT specialists are vital. This ensures that the data collected and analyzed accurately reflects the patient’s condition and treatment plan.

4. Ethical Considerations: Handling sensitive health information requires a strong understanding of privacy laws and ethical guidelines. This ensures that all data is managed and analyzed in a compliant and respectful manner.

Best Practices for Success in Clinical Coding Analytics

To excel in clinical coding analytics, it’s important to follow best practices that enhance your expertise and contribute to better healthcare outcomes. Some of these practices include:

1. Staying Updated with Regulatory Changes: Healthcare regulations and coding standards are continuously evolving. Staying informed about changes in ICD codes, HIPAA regulations, and other relevant policies is crucial for maintaining accuracy and compliance.

2. Leveraging Technology: Utilizing advanced analytics tools and software can significantly improve the efficiency and accuracy of your work. Tools like machine learning algorithms and data visualization platforms can help in identifying trends and patterns that might not be immediately apparent.

3. Continuous Learning and Development: The field of clinical coding analytics is dynamic, and there is always room for improvement. Participating in workshops, webinars, and courses can help you stay ahead of the curve and enhance your skills.

4. Building a Network: Connecting with other professionals in the field can provide valuable insights and opportunities. Networking at conferences, joining professional associations, and participating in online forums can help you stay informed and engaged.

Career Opportunities in Clinical Coding Analytics

The skills and knowledge gained through the Professional Certificate in Clinical Coding Analytics for Decision Making open up a variety of career paths. Here are some of the key roles you can pursue:

1. Clinical Data Analyst: You can work as a clinical data analyst, where you will be responsible for analyzing and interpreting clinical data to support healthcare decision-making.

2. Health Informatician: By combining clinical coding knowledge with informatics skills, you can work on projects that involve the design, implementation, and evaluation of information systems in healthcare settings.

3. Healthcare IT Specialist: This role involves working with healthcare IT systems, ensuring that data is collected, stored, and analyzed accurately and efficiently.

4. Quality Improvement Specialist: By leveraging data analytics, you can contribute to improving the quality of healthcare services and patient outcomes.
